Palace Cinemas is an Australian cinema chain specializing in arthouse and international films, founded in 1965 by Antonio Zeccola and headquartered in the Melbourne suburb of South Yarra. It operates cinemas across multiple Australian states screening independent and foreign language films rather than mainstream releases, and beyond exhibition it also distributes and produces films, including the Australian titles Kokoda and Chopper, while organizing numerous international film festivals around the country.
